Output 19e868eeb11e8bf19bc7d21ac4199d3a793a783592de3cc0b532686382179609: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3d2d6c175713973211528edb00584f5934ee7f0 OP_EQUALVERIFY OP_CHECKSIG
address
1PEDmxYYC28PMynfwfVPSR3rUWwmi7EaUY
transaction
19e868eeb11e8bf19bc7d21ac4199d3a793a783592de3cc0b532686382179609
spent
true